The Banias, also known by its Hebrew name "Nahal Hermon", is one of the three sources of the Jordan and supplies about a quarter of the river's water.
The length of the stream is nine kilometers and it collects a number of tributaries, such as Nahal Sa'ar, Govta, Shion and others, but most of its water comes from springs that result from seepage of rainwater and melting snow from the Hermon. The waterfall of the stream is one of its most recognizable symbols, and during the winter it falls With a strong and impressive power. It is not for nothing that the Banias was chosen as the most beautiful place in Israel, and it seems to have everything: abundant water, vegetation and flowers on its banks, hiking trails of various lengths, accessibility and beauty that always expands the heart.

The Western Wall, a symbol for every Jew, may not be a natural site with water and flowers, but for Israelis it symbolizes belonging, history and a heritage that has been going on for thousands of years, and that wall that remains on its end is the only remnant left of the Temple rebuilt by King Herod about 2,000 years ago.

Third place - the desert wonder
The geological wonder of the Ramon Crater - the largest crater in Israel - which won
7.73% of all the votes, came
in third place,
with a small difference from the second place .
The length of the Ramon Crater is 40 km by 9 km and it is one of three craters in Israel, in addition to the Small Crater (Hatzra) and the Yeruhem Crater (Hatira) and the only one in the Middle East that has been declared an "International Starlight Reserve".
The Israel Trail passes through the Ramon Crater and is considered one of the most beloved desert shows in Israel.
